The carrying capacity of the environment refers to the maximum number of individuals or activities an environment can support without causing significant negative impacts. It includes factors like resource availability, habitat space, and the ability to absorb waste and regenerate.
**Need for Sustainable Tourism in India’s Hilly Areas:**
1. **Environmental Preservation**: Hilly areas like the Himalayas are ecologically sensitive. Sustainable tourism ensures that natural resources, such as forests, water bodies, and wildlife, are protected. Over-tourism can lead to deforestation, water pollution, and habitat destruction.
2. **Cultural Integrity**: Hilly regions often have unique cultures and traditions. Sustainable tourism respects and preserves local customs and heritage, preventing them from being overshadowed by mass tourism.
3. **Economic Benefits**: Sustainable tourism can provide long-term economic benefits to local communities. By promoting eco-friendly practices, locals can engage in tourism without depleting their natural resources, ensuring continued income.
4. **Quality of Life**: Limiting the number of tourists to match the carrying capacity reduces overcrowding and strain on local infrastructure. This improves the quality of life for residents and provides a better experience for visitors.
5. **Climate Change Mitigation**: Sustainable tourism practices, such as reducing carbon footprints and promoting eco-friendly transportation, help mitigate climate change impacts, which are particularly severe in hilly areas.
In conclusion, sustainable tourism is essential for protecting India’s hilly areas, ensuring that these regions can continue to thrive ecologically, culturally, and economically.

Indeed, sustainable development is known to offer the creation of new employs on diversified spheres of the economy. The move towards a greener economy promotes innovation, green investments, changes in behavior and therefore job creation. Here’s how:
Key Areas of Job Creation
1. Renewable Energy:
Investment in technology and systems of solar, wind, and even hydroelectric power means employment of professionals to install, maintain or operate the systems.
– Example: The global body responsible for the promotion of the use of renewable energy, the International Renewable Energy Agency, IRENA, argues that approximately 38 million people could be employed in the renewable energy sector by the year 2030.
2. Energy Efficiency:
Energy conservation starts with retrofitting existing buildings, engineering energy-efficient appliances, and technology and smart meters all require engineers, technicians, and project managers.
3. Sustainable Agriculture:
There are increasing opportunities in organic farming, precision agriculture, agroforestry and sustainable fisheries.
They also enhance resilience in rural economies .
4. Green Infrastructure and Urban Planning:
It employmenets people in construction of environment friendly structures like green buildings, smart cities and transport systems.
5. Waste Management and Circular Economy:
This in turn means job creation in material recovery, product redesign and in waste processing through recycling, up cycling and waste to energy.
6. Environmental Conservation:
Conservation of the environment through restoration projects, the provision of habitats for bio-diversity, and afforestation creates management and research employment opportunities.
